About The Position

As the premium provider of drinking water and water treatment services for the greater part of a century, Hall’s Culligan continues to innovate and expand our business nationwide by offering tailored solutions to meet the specific needs of each customer backed by our superior Culligan service. As a Hall's Culligan Office Manager, you'll ensure smooth office operations by handling customer interactions, resolving issues, and supporting cross-functional teams. This role involves monitoring customer communications, troubleshooting problems, and collaborating with departments for timely resolutions. The Office Manager also manages scheduling, billing, office tasks, and provides regular reports to the General Manager, while maintaining compliance standards.

Requirements

  • Previous experience in a customer service role preferred.
  • Excellent verbal and written communication skills.
  • Excellent organization and multi-tasking skills.
  • Strong problem-solving abilities and attention to detail.
  • Proficient in using a CRM platform.

Responsibilities

  • Monitors customer interactions via phone & email, using tracking software when applicable, including call center monitoring.
  • Effectively and accurately addresses escalated customer concerns, troubleshoots problems, and provides accurate information.
  • Owns issue resolution, and collaborates with other departments when necessary.
  • Comfortable handling heightened conflicts, and difficult conversations.
  • Works with departments to coordinate the removal of rental equipment when customers fail to pay.
  • Develop and maintain an understanding of our products and services to effectively assist customers and addresses their needs.
  • Offer product/service recommendations and educate customers.
  • Ensures customer interactions and transactions are documented properly in customer service software.
  • Works with upper leadership on creating and pulling reports needed.
  • Ensure payroll commissions, bonuses, and other compensation are assembled, balanced to WaterFlex, and submitted to payroll by the payroll submission deadline without errors or omissions.
  • Month end processing of bills and reports.
  • Efficiently manage and prioritize tasks to meet individual and team performance goals.
  • Meet deadlines and response times while maintaining quality in work and customer interactions.
  • Works with collections agencies as needed.
  • Manage general office staff duties to include by not be limited to, assisting walk-in customers, balancing cash register, phone coverage and call tracking, scheduling install and service calls, customer account adjustments, balancing route and bottled water sales pay sheets, etc.
  • Ensures dealership operations comply with all safety regulations, industry standards, and company policies.
  • Leads safety training and enforces protocols to maintain a safe environment for employees and customers.
  • Oversees incident reporting and investigations, ensuring proper documentation and resolution.
  • Responds to emergencies, providing direction to minimize disruption and ensure safety.
  • Maintains compliance with legal requirements and safety standards, working with legal and insurance teams as needed.
  • Ensures confidentiality of sensitive customer and employee information.
